Hanging out in my rock wall. Can't get a clean shot because of the rocks & he won't lay his head out on the flat where we can chop it. Pretty stinkin' inconsiderate if you ask me. :mad:

Ya think a blast with a fire extinguisher would chill him sufficiently so he could be hooked out & permanently dispatched?

I don't think that chilling him would kill him unless you could freeze his head almost solid. He would just slow down so that you could hopefully handle him safely.

Snakes only take 1-2 breaths per minute, and can hold their breath for extended periods of time (minutes), so if you are hoping fumes will drive him out, you might have a long wait. Gasoline on him will at least make him move somehere.
